Mobile Device Analyst

The person should have sound knowledge and Hands on Experience on the following:
Deploy, manage, and maintain mobile applications, including updates and patches.
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ues related to mobile device management, mobile application management, and mobile app deployment.
Support the architecture, engineering, maintenance and operation of the MDM management platform and related MDM infrastructure.
Handle end-user support requests.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op and implement technical solutions that improve the performance and reliability of our mobile devices and applications.
Develop and maintain documentation related to mobile device management, mobile application management, and mobile app deployment.
Experience in mobile device management, mobile application management, and mobile app deployment.
Strong knowledge of mobile operating systems, including iOS and Android.
Experience with mobile management platforms including MobileIron and Microsoft Intune.
End-Points Life cycle management like feature update, upgrades etc.
Work with the IT Security team to maintain mobile security policies and procedures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ills.
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
Desired:
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ems or related field or equivalent work experience Required:

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
